Understanding RFID Technology in Packaging
RFID, or Radio Frequency Identification, utilizes electromagnetic fields to automatically identify and track tags attached to objects. In the context of packaging, RFID technology significantly enhances the tracking and identification of products throughout the supply chain. By integrating RFID appearance detection machines into your packaging operations, you can achieve higher levels of accuracy in quality control, reducing errors and improving overall efficiency.

Key Features to Look for in RFID Appearance Detection Machines
Choosing the right RFID appearance detection machine requires understanding the critical features that can impact performance:
1. Read Range
The read range of an RFID machine determines how far away it can effectively detect tags. Depending on your packaging setup, you may need machines with shorter or longer read ranges to accommodate your operational needs.
2. Speed and Throughput
The efficiency of your packaging process relies heavily on the speed of the RFID appearance detection machine. Look for machines that can handle your required throughput without compromising accuracy.
3. Compatibility with Packaging Materials
Ensure that the RFID machine is compatible with the materials you use for packaging, such as plastics, metals, or cardboard. Some materials may interfere with RFID signal transmission, impacting detection accuracy.
4. Integration Capabilities
Check if the RFID appearance detection machine can seamlessly integrate with your existing packaging systems and software. This compatibility is vital for achieving a cohesive operational flow.
5. User-Friendly Interface
A machine with a simple interface can significantly reduce training time for staff, making it easier for your team to operate effectively.
